I looked in the archive, the configure script seems missing, only the configure.ac is present, I'll check again later.
|
Quote:
|
Im learning a lot in this thread, all very very intresting :-)
The 2.5.12dev builds again on my G4 but I noticed a thing while I was trying Pinball Fantasies CD32 edition, here is my configuration for this game: Code:
[config] Code:
IMMEDIATE BLITTER AND WAITING BLITS CAN'T BE ENABLED SIMULTANEOUSLY |
Wow this is nice! Looking forward to try it on my iBook G4 :D
Where can I get the binary? I can't do those compile things etc ;_; |
Don't expect too much Akira, FS-UAE is focusing on accuracy instead of speed. My configuration is a PowerMac MDD with 2x1.50 GHz G4 Cpu, 2 Gb of RAM with CL2 latency and a Radeon X800XT, even if this setup is a really fast G4 the most part of Amiga programs I launch runs choppy but I am not worried about that because If I want pure fun (with the good old amiga demos for example) I run E-UAE JIT and I'm happy.
FS-UAE is much up-to-date compared to E-UAE and I always preferred accuracy and completeness over speed, if I can't run smoothly a program is my bad because my slow computer but with a G5 machine things would be very different. I also hope that someday the E-UAE mantainers will look into FS-UAE project to put together the best and fastest Amiga emulator for OSX PPC Macs available :-) About the FS-UAE PPC binary you will find the 2.5.11dev version in The Zone area, I upload every successful build there. Have fun :-) |
Quote:
It is fixed in the latest commit on gtihub. Also in the latest commit: --disable-cpuboard is neither needed nor supported any longer. You only need to use --disable-ppc (cpuboard will be enabled but without actual PPC emulation). |
Seems that --disable-ppc option does need some fine tuning because the compiling went stuck again at this point:
Code:
(...) Code:
cc1plus: warning: command line option "-Wmissing-declarations" is valid for C/ObjC but not for C++ ./bootstrap.sh export SDL2_CFLAGS="-I/Library/Frameworks/SDL2.framework/Versions/A/Headers" export SDL2_LIBS="-F/Library/Frameworks -framework SDL2" export OPENAL_CFLAGS="-I/opt/local/Library/Frameworks/OpenAL.framework/Versions/A/Headers" export OPENAL_LIBS="-F/opt/local/Library/Frameworks -framework OpenAL" ./configure --disable-ppc cd macosx make |
Quote:
Quote:
|
Version 2.5.12dev for OSX PPC is finally up and running, already uploaded to The Zone! :-)
|
SnakeCoils!!!
Quote:
How to come in touch with you in fast way? About FSuae Now the core of winuae is Qemu and im pretty sure the next FSuae will be compatible with PowerMacs in PPC too. I had been try to compile last dev build but without result the gcc ansking for SDL 2.0 . Do you have a repository like you made for Mame Sdl for the FSuae binary ? My config is : PowerMac G5 Quad 2.5 ghz 8gb Ram and 7800gtx 512mb SSHD AMIGA RULEZ! |
Quote:
For all the other infos I sent you a PM. @Frode: the actual 2.5.14 development release can't be build on OSX ppc, I declared as usual the SDL2 and OpenAL cflags and libs and then configure with the following options --disable-ppc --disable-pearpc-cpu --disable-qemu-cpu but the process stopped at this point: Code:
gcc -DHAVE_CONFIG_H -I. -DMACOSX -DUAE -DFSUAE -I./flac/include -I./gen -I./src -I./src/jit -I./src/include -I./src/od-fs -I./src/od-fs/include -I./src/od-win32 -I./src/od-win32/caps -I./libfsemu/include -I./glee -I./manymouse -I./src/slirp/include -I./libudis86/include -I./libmpeg2/include -I/opt/local/include/freetype2 -I/opt/local/include -I/opt/local/include/libpng16 -D_REENTRANT -I/opt/local/include/glib-2.0 -I/opt/local/lib/glib-2.0/include -I/opt/local/include -DLUA_USE_POSIX -I/opt/local/Library/Frameworks/OpenAL.framework/Versions/A/Headers -I/opt/local/include/libpng16 -I/Library/Frameworks/SDL2.framework/Versions/A/Headers -I/opt/local/include -Wmissing-declarations -fvisibility=hidden -std=gnu99 -g -O2 -MT src/fs-uae/video.o -MD -MP -MF $depbase.Tpo -c -o src/fs-uae/video.o src/fs-uae/video.c &&\ |
Quote:
https://github.com/FrodeSolheim/fs-u...69512b7896990b Quote:
|
Excellent work! :-) The 2.5.14 development OSX PPC binary has been build successfully and already uploaded in The Zone. Thanks a lot! ;-)
|
Quote:
If one day will be possible have it working like Shaepshaver the performance will be outstanding ... Check here :) http://i1249.photobucket.com/albums/...ps4522e6bd.jpg |
As far as I know, QEMU runs on PPC, so there's no inherent reason why FS-UAE + QEMU-UAE (PPC) couldn't work (but it is possible a tweak or two is needed sine no-one has tested it yet). Just don't expect me to do anything about it :)
QEMU-UAE source code here: https://github.com/FrodeSolheim/qemu-uae (Instructions on how to create the qemu-uae *plugin* after qemu-uae has been compiled will be provided later) |
Quote:
I need to report a couple of bugs to SnaKeCoils Pratically i had been made the configuration file: Quote:
Code:
WARNING: fs_emu_theme_get_resource_path (title_font.png) is deprecated Plus on window i have all the time A500 model not others. Thank you :) |
Byte 92 is also "\". So it sounds like the problem is that all your lines are really ending in "\" (though they don't in your above paste). Please check the config file in another text editor and make sure to remove any "\" at the end of lines...
|
Quote:
i dont know why Textedit save the file in rtf mode :guru... i had been fixed with nano .:cheese Will report soon my experience :great:great And why not one day have the FS-Euae :) With the help of Almos and Tobias ;) I will do the same that i did :P https://www.youtube.com/watch?v=xqcZ...9d-x_tn2FXLojQ |
Quote:
FS-UAE Pros: Always up-to-date with the parent project WinUAE and therefore the best and accurate Amiga emulation available for all non-Windows machines. Cons: Not optimized for PPC, no JIT recompiler. To have a reasonable speed on G4 machines accuracy must be kept as low as possible and at this level many programs and demos have glitches. E-UAE JIT Pros: Very fast and nice features like led activity for various emulated devices. Cons: It is based on a quite old source that is inaccurate here and there, expecially in the custom chips emulation. For example if you run the demo Arte (from Sanity) you will notice that on E-UAE the white bars on walls in the tunnel sequence are completely missing, only the floor and ceiling realtime zooming and perspective textures are displayed. On FS-UAE everything is in the right place. The Arte demo is really a nice benchmark for emulators because it have both parts where only CPU is involved and others where the blitter is called to do the heaviest job: thanks to the activity led of E-UAE is easy to see where the JIT engine operates and where it is the blitter turn. One thing I have noticed is that FS-UAE 68k cpu emulation is not that bad if compared to the JIT part of E-UAE (look at starfield animation in the middle part of the demo, it runs almost the same speed on both emulators and is a CPU-only part), the great speed advantage of E-UAE is mainly because of its much more simpler custom chips emulation. Unfortunately there is little that can be do for optimize that part, I think we will never see a JIT emulation for Amiga custom chips because the accuracy in this part is the hearth of the whole emulation. A G5 machine is the right choice for a decent FS-UAE Amiga emulation at a normal accuracy level, my G4 can't compete on compute power but with a careful tuning here and there the results are of absolute satisfaction :-) |
i can say for sure the g5 quad is a great machine worst supported by apple (the horrible apple policy) i had many poc machine from the classic a4000 to mini g4 to the powerbooks and all the ng amigas (not x1000 soon x5000)
and intel last gen mac too... the g5 continue be my favorite if i compare the age of it with the performance. ok returning it topic. the fs- uae gave me with opitimized =0 about 13mips performance model a4000 euae in not jit 38mips in jit 98/105 (and tobias make many turn round for have this performance because the really poor documentations of the cpu. ) i will check better the compatibility in next days for fs uae and report. im sure if one day fs uae will have the "virtualized" cpu like sheepshaver on the g5 we will face a ultra fast machine with aos 4.1 .:great the problem of euae is yes old build , but much more worts only interpretative fpu :( hope in future everything will be better:great |
All times are GMT +2. The time now is 15:52. |
Powered by vBulletin® Version 3.8.11
Copyright ©2000 - 2024, vBulletin Solutions Inc.